Caution: Do not remove the roller assembly from the case unless 

necessary for repairs. If the roller assembly is removed, be sure mo-

tor is fully re-seated in the bracket, and re-secure it carefully with the 

motor retaining spring and screw (see diagram below).

Please note: Maximum 

torque for tightening 

screw is 5 lb-inches.

Tab-Tension Adjustment Procedure

Draper’s Tab-Tensioning System is factory-set, and under normal circumstances will not require field adjustment.  
If, however, you notice wrinkles, waves or other indications that the tensioning cables need to be adjusted, follow the procedure below.

1

  Determine which side requires adjustment.

2

  Secure dowel with one hand.

3

  Using Phillips-head screwdriver, depress spring-loaded adjustment screw and slowly turn 

CLOCKWISE TO INCREASE tension,  

 or 

COUNTER-CLOCKWISE TO RELEASE tension. The screw adjusts in ¼ turn increments. Adjust only one increment (¼ turn) at a time

4

  If problem is not corrected, leave screen in position for 24 hours to allow surface material to stretch into position.

5

  If problem still is not corrected, repeat steps 2 and 3.

Caution: Do not touch  
or bend surface.
